编程比赛裁判员是什么
-
编程比赛裁判员是负责监督和评判编程比赛的人员。他们的主要职责是确保比赛的公平性和顺利进行。以下是关于编程比赛裁判员的详细内容。
第一部分:职责和责任
编程比赛裁判员的主要职责包括:- 确保比赛规则的执行:裁判员必须熟悉比赛规则,并确保参赛选手在比赛中遵守这些规则。
- 监督比赛过程:裁判员需要监督比赛的进行,包括确保比赛开始和结束的时间,检查参赛选手的程序是否符合要求等。
- 解决问题和争议:在比赛过程中,可能会出现问题和争议。裁判员需要及时处理这些问题,并做出公正的决策。
- 评分和排名:裁判员需要根据比赛规则和评分标准对参赛选手的程序进行评分,并根据评分结果进行排名。
第二部分:技能和素质要求
作为编程比赛裁判员,需要具备以下技能和素质:- 编程知识:裁判员需要具备扎实的编程知识,能够理解和评估参赛选手的程序。
- 公正和客观:裁判员需要保持公正和客观的态度,不偏袒任何一方,并根据事实和规则做出决策。
- 沟通能力:裁判员需要与参赛选手、其他裁判员和组织者进行有效的沟通,解答问题和解决争议。
- 压力处理能力:比赛过程中可能会出现紧张和压力,裁判员需要能够冷静应对,保持良好的心态和工作效率。
第三部分:裁判员的工作流程
编程比赛裁判员的工作流程通常包括以下步骤:- 准备工作:裁判员需要提前熟悉比赛规则和评分标准,并与其他裁判员和组织者进行沟通,确保大家对比赛流程和要求有一致的理解。
- 比赛前的检查:在比赛开始前,裁判员需要检查比赛场地和设备是否正常运行,并准备好必要的评分表和纪录工具。
- 比赛进行中的监督和评分:在比赛过程中,裁判员需要监督参赛选手的操作和程序运行,并根据评分标准对其进行评分。
- 问题处理和决策:如果出现问题和争议,裁判员需要及时处理并做出公正的决策,确保比赛的公平性和顺利进行。
- 比赛结束后的总结和评估:比赛结束后,裁判员需要与其他裁判员和组织者进行总结和评估,提出改进建议和意见。
总结:
编程比赛裁判员是负责监督和评判编程比赛的人员,他们需要确保比赛的公平性和顺利进行。作为裁判员,需要具备扎实的编程知识、公正和客观的态度、良好的沟通能力和压力处理能力。他们的工作流程包括准备工作、比赛前的检查、比赛进行中的监督和评分、问题处理和决策,以及比赛结束后的总结和评估。1年前 -
编程比赛裁判员是负责监督和评判编程比赛的人员。他们确保比赛的公平性和规则的执行,同时负责记录和计算参赛者的得分。
以下是关于编程比赛裁判员的一些要点:
-
规则制定和解释:裁判员负责制定比赛规则,并解释给参赛者和观众。他们确保比赛的公平性和一致性,防止任何不公正行为。
-
比赛监督:裁判员在比赛期间监督参赛者的行为和活动。他们确保参赛者遵守规则,不进行作弊或其他违规行为。
-
评判参赛者的代码:裁判员负责评判参赛者提交的代码。他们检查代码的正确性、效率和可读性。根据比赛规则和要求,他们判定参赛者是否达到了预期的标准。
-
计算得分:裁判员根据比赛规则和评判标准计算参赛者的得分。他们考虑代码的正确性、效率和可读性等因素,以确定参赛者在比赛中的表现。
-
处理争议和申诉:如果参赛者或观众对裁判员的决定有异议,裁判员负责处理争议和申诉。他们会仔细审查相关证据和规则,并作出公正的决定。
编程比赛裁判员在比赛中扮演着关键的角色。他们确保比赛的公平性,保证参赛者按照规则进行比赛,并正确评判参赛者的表现。他们的工作需要具备扎实的编程知识和经验,以及良好的判断力和公正性。
1年前 -
-
编程比赛裁判员是负责管理和裁定编程比赛的专业人员。他们负责确保比赛的公平性和准确性,并监督参赛选手的表现。裁判员的工作包括评估参赛选手的代码、测试其程序的正确性、记录比赛结果以及回答参赛选手的问题。在编程比赛中,裁判员的角色非常重要,他们需要具备丰富的编程知识和经验,并能够在紧张的比赛环境下准确、公正地判定选手的成绩。
下面将从裁判员的角度,介绍编程比赛的一般操作流程和裁判员的具体工作内容。
1. 编程比赛的一般操作流程
1.1 准备阶段
在比赛开始前,裁判员需要进行一系列的准备工作,包括:
- 确定比赛的规则和要求,包括比赛的时间、题目数量、编程语言限制等。
- 设计和准备比赛的题目和测试数据。
- 配置比赛的评测系统,确保其正常运行。
1.2 比赛阶段
在比赛开始后,裁判员需要执行以下操作:
- 指导选手登录比赛系统,获取题目和提交代码的方式。
- 监督选手的比赛过程,确保选手遵守比赛规则。
- 答复选手的问题,解决他们在比赛中遇到的技术问题。
- 接收选手提交的代码,并将其提交到评测系统中进行评测。
- 监控评测系统的运行情况,确保评测结果的准确性。
- 验证评测结果,确认选手的代码是否符合题目要求。
- 记录选手的成绩和排名,并及时更新比赛的实时排行榜。
1.3 比赛结束阶段
在比赛结束后,裁判员需要执行以下操作:
- 统计选手的成绩和排名,确定比赛的最终结果。
- 宣布比赛的结果,并颁发奖项给获胜者。
- 整理比赛的数据和记录,并备份相关文件。
- 反馈比赛情况,提供改进建议和意见。
2. 裁判员的具体工作内容
2.1 比赛前的准备工作
- 确定比赛规则和要求,包括比赛时间、规模、题目数量、编程语言限制等。
- 设计和准备比赛的题目和测试数据,确保题目的难度适中、测试数据的充分和合理。
- 配置比赛的评测系统,包括安装和配置评测机、编译器、运行环境等。
2.2 比赛中的工作
- 指导选手登录比赛系统,解答选手关于比赛规则和操作方式的问题。
- 监督选手的比赛过程,确保选手遵守比赛规则和道德规范。
- 接收选手提交的代码,并将其提交到评测系统中进行评测。
- 监控评测系统的运行情况,确保评测结果的准确性和及时性。
- 验证评测结果,确认选手的代码是否符合题目要求,并给出评分。
- 记录选手的成绩和排名,并及时更新比赛的实时排行榜。
- 回答选手的问题,解决他们在比赛中遇到的技术问题。
- 处理选手的申诉和异议,确保比赛的公平性和公正性。
2.3 比赛后的工作
- 统计选手的成绩和排名,确定比赛的最终结果。
- 宣布比赛的结果,并颁发奖项给获胜者。
- 整理比赛的数据和记录,并备份相关文件。
- 反馈比赛情况,提供改进建议和意见。
以上是编程比赛裁判员的一般工作内容和操作流程。裁判员在比赛中扮演着重要的角色,他们需要具备专业的编程知识和技能,以及良好的组织和沟通能力。裁判员的工作不仅要求准确和公正,还需要保持冷静和耐心,处理好各种意外情况和紧急情况。只有这样,才能确保比赛的顺利进行和公平公正的评判。
1年前